Managing System Configurations

Learn how to configure system attributes like: Device Custom Attribute Label, Mails, SetClock, System, etc.

The system configuration feature provides a user interface to manage various configurations that compose the system and its boundary. This feature provides a graphical interface for managing the system related configurations.

To configure the system:

  1. Go to Administration > Estate Administration > System Configuration.
  2. Select a configurable value in Category drop-down.

The below table lists the category attribute with description:

Category

Description

Device Custom Attribute Label

Indicates the attribute labels created by users manually. The user can create maximum five custom attributes.

Mails

Indicates the e-mail configuration settings.

Scheduler

Indicates the schedule settings for actions, downloads etc.

Schedules and Timers

Indicates the schedule and time settings for different windows services.

Security

Indicates the security settings for the VHQ application.

Set Clock

Indicates the timestamp value, which the server instructs the device to set in the device. This value is generated by the server for the agent to set.

Setup

Indicates the location settings for different types of logs.

System

Indicates the system and application level settings.
